Transaction 56c949ee9677f822c7fb85640c658a43e780798c0433b125687c94dfd1915f90
1 Input
1 Output
-
56c949ee9677f822c7fb85640c658a43e780798c0433b125687c94dfd1915f90:0
- value
- 24992700
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 26559bb361f5a93a0aa3363d4e3816d72fc15cab OP_EQUALVERIFY OP_CHECKSIG
- address
- 14VhETDTvJ6YwJxrrjSRLpjgrgCnBEKq43